Designed to promote innovation, the Entrepreneurial Project (EP) is a central element of the ESSEC & MANNHEIM Executive MBA program. The scope and content of the project is determined by participants and possibly their companies.
You will be challenged to transform ideas into concrete achievements and to apply the cross-disciplinary knowledge you have acquired throughout the course of the program to a real life case.
By immersing yourself into a business venture that is unlike anything else you would have already experience in your career, the Entrepreneurial Project tests your strength in adapting to an unfamiliar environment and helps you to fully explore the breadth and depth of your abilities, functional and social.

Our faculty, managers and alumni provide advice and guidelines for the projects, while participants develop their ideas and define the skills needed for the project. In the end the teams present their project before a jury that consists of academics as well as top managers, among them also program alumni.
